Lowering Nitrogen Rates under the System of Rice Intensification Enhanced Rice Productivity and Nitrogen Use Efficiency in Irrigated Lowland Rice

0 Comments

Among the essential plant nutrients, nitrogen (N) is the most important and universally deficient in rice cropping systems worldwide. Despite different practices available for improvement of N management, nitrogen use efficiency (NUE) is still very low in rice, particularly under conventional management practices. Product Water Footprint on Rice Cultivation in Intermediate Zone, Sri Lanka: A Case Study in Kurunegala District, Sri Lanka

Water consumption by crops for ensuring food security for a growing population has become a threat to the limited natural resource of freshwater.
